: : : I have had 7 cases of pericarditis since April.  Just got put on cochisine this month.
: It seems to be holding it, but it is too early to tell.  What can you tell us about
: the medicene?
: Thank you
Dear Mary
Colchicine is different sort of medicine to quiet down inflammation. It is widely used in treating gout (a form of arthritis). It also has a role in recurrent pericarditis that is not as widely known.
